Recent reviews for Samsung CLX-3175FW Multifunction Printer




Reviewed By: PLI on 5/20/2010 12:44:28 AM
Overall ratings: 8.0 out of 10
Pros:
Low cost for a color laser MFP; small footprint; looks good; scan to usb/email; print from usb very convenient; wireless; first print out speed; and print speed.
Cons:
Scan to email feature requires a non-ssl SMTP mail server which is difficulty to find these days. Driver software is quite large.
Comment about Samsung CLX-3175FW Multifunction Printer
It is hard to describe - the machine gives off a "dry heat" sensation although it does not feel hot to touch. Some reviews say that it is difficult to set up the wireless connection. The "how to" guides on Samsung's website are helpful. It is quite easy if you have the instruction.




Reviewed By: Shane on 2/27/2010 6:30:40 PM
Overall ratings: 6.9 out of 10
Pros:
Small size, low cost, Mac software was included.
Cons:
Wireless was a HUGE pain to setup, and I'm a former network admin. I can't imagine how the average person could do it. In fact, I'm not sure how I did it. It just started working on its own after I had given up on it and walked away. The manual is no help at all. I had to get online and sift through some forums to figure out how to set it up. And it didn't have a USB cable with it, but that's normal these days.
Comment about Samsung CLX-3175FW Multifunction Printer
For the price, it's a reasonable deal, especially considering that it's wireless. It prints doents very well, but it is not a photo printer at all. It's a great home or home office printer, especially at this price. I bought this to replace an inkjet printer, but have kept the inkjet around just for photo printing. Also, it is allegedly a wireless scanner, but I have yet to successfully scan a single doent. Maybe that will start working on its own too. One odd thing is the power it draws. When I hit print, the lights in my living room dim, so I suspect it pulls considerable current. Be aware that this thing also puts out a great deal of heat.
